2. Accounting Policies
2.1. Basis of Preparation of Financial Statements
The financial statements have been prepared under the historical cost convention and in accordance with Financial Reporting Standard 102 section 1A Small Entities "The Financial Reporting Standard applicable in the UK and Republic of Ireland" and the Companies Act 2006.
2.2. Turnover
Turnover is measured at the fair value of the consideration received or receivable, net of discounts and value added taxes. Turnover includes revenue earned from the sale of goods and from the rendering of services. Turnover is reduced for estimated customer returns, rebates and other similar allowances.
Turnover from the rendering of services is recognised by reference to the stage of completion of the contract. The stage of completion of a contract is measured by comparing the costs incurred for work performed to date to the total estimated contract costs. Turnover is only recognised to the extent of recoverable expenses when the outcome of a contract cannot be estimated reliably.
2.3. Taxation
The company has an obligation to pay all taxable profits to its parent charity under gift aid.
Where payment of the company's taxable profits to the parent charity falls after the reporting date, the income tax effects of that gift aid payment are still recognised at the reporting date. The income tax effects are measured consistently with the tax treatment planned to be used in the company’s income tax filings, and a deferred tax liability is not recognised in relation to such a gift aid payment.
2.4. Trade and other debtors
Trade and other debtors are initially recognised at fair value and thereafter stated at amortised cost using the effective interest method, less impairment losses for bad or doubtful debts except where the effect of discounting would be immaterial. In such cases, the receivables are stated at cost less impairment losses for bad or doubtful debts.
2.5. Trade and other creditors
Trade and other creditors are initially recognised at fair value and thereafter stated at amortised cost using the effective interest method unless the effect of discounting would be immaterial, in which case they are stated at cost.

8. Related Party Transactions
Controlling party
The company is a wholly owned subsidiary of Rural Media Charity, a charitable company limited by guarantee (company no. 02732325, charity no. 1041335). Rural Media Charity made charges for contributions to production costs, wages and salaries of £49,535 (2024: £52,897) to Rural Studios. At 31 March 2025, Rural Studios owed Rural Media Charity £120,732 (2023: £117,544).
